Priyanka Chopra has experienced the highs and lows of Hollywood so far.

The Bollywood actress has suffered another disappointment as her upcoming movie, Cowboy Ninja Viking, has been shelved by Universal.

Chris Pratt was set to star in the movie and filming had been scheduled to commence mid-August in London ahead of a 28 June 2019 release date.

According to The Hollywood Reporter, Priyanka, 36, was due to play the female lead role but Universal decided to push it back to a later date in order to accommodate production scheduling. Since March, rumours had circulated that the movie would be pulled due to ongoing script issues.

Cowboy, which is still in active development, was being helmed by Michelle MacLaren who has directed several episodes of Game of Thrones. There were high hopes for the movie as Universal were planning on turning it into a blockbuster franchise with an initial $65 million (£50.3 million) budget.

The movie is being adapted from the Image Comics book of the same name and follows a counterintelligence group of Multiple Personality Disorder patients who transform into agents, some of whom eventually become hired killers.

It comes just days after Priyanka quit Bollywood movie, Bharat, and following the final episode of her Hollywood TV series, Quantico, which was cancelled.

Priyankas involvement with the project was announced less than two weeks after she pulled out of Bharat in July.

Director Ali Abbas seemed to suggest that the reason for Priyankas departure was because she had got engaged to Nick Jonas, something which is yet to be confirmed. A Bharat producer later called Priyanka unprofessional for quitting at such short notice.

News of Cowboys stalling is just the latest disappointment for Priyanka, who transitioned from Bollywood to Hollywood movies two years ago. The actress has been forced to bid farewell to her TV show, Quantico, which was cancelled after three seasons.
